Moog Wolverhampton is seeking a skilled and proactive Hydraulic & Mechanical Technician to join our Test Equipment Sustainment and Site Maintenance teams. In this hands-on role, you will perform sustainment, maintenance, and upgrade activities across a wide range of machinery and hydraulic/pneumatic test systems. You will play a vital part in keeping production operations running reliably and safely, ensuring equipment is maintained, compliant, and ready to support ongoing business needs.
Working with multidisciplinary engineering and maintenance teams, you will troubleshoot issues, execute planned and unplanned maintenance, maintain equipment configuration, and uphold Moog’s high standards for safety, quality, and operational excellence.
Key Responsibilities- Investigate and resolve equipment issues causing production stops, quality escapes, or reduced first-pass yield.
- Perform planned and reactive maintenance across machinery and test equipment—hydraulic, pneumatic, mechanical, electronic, electrical, and software-based systems.
- Conduct component-level repairs, often with limited drawing coverage.
- Ensure all work complies with relevant standards, regulations, and best practice.
- Maintain configuration control of all machinery and test equipment deployed on site.
- Create and update documentation during fault-finding, maintenance, and upgrade activities.
- Supervise third-party contractors in accordance with Moog’s contractor control and compliance processes.
- Manage work assignments and maintenance records using the Moog Maintenance Management System (Pirana).
- Support root-cause investigations involving machinery and test systems.
- Complete and review risk assessments; ensure safe working practices are followed at all times.
- Support internal and external quality audits relating to machinery and test systems.
- Participate in Lean activities to improve test equipment and site functions.
- Perform basic IT tasks, including email communications, Teams usage, intranet navigation, and electronic ordering.
- Specify parts to support effective inventory management for equipment maintenance.
- Support creation and maintenance of Standard Operating Procedures (including Lock, Tag, Try) and act as an authorised competent party.
